How much do associate sales account man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 25, 2026, the average yearly pay for associate sales account manager in Reston, VA is $53,971.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,700.00 and $61,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an associate sales account manager do?

An Associate Sales Account Manager supports senior sales staff in managing client accounts, identifying sales opportunities, and ensuring customer satisfaction. They help maintain relationships with existing clients, assist in preparing sales presentations, and process orders or contracts. Additionally, they may be responsible for tracking sales performance, resolving customer issues, and collaborating with other departments to meet client needs. This role serves as a stepping stone to more senior sales positions by developing essential account management sk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ate sales account manager?

To thrive as an Associate Sales Account Manager, you need a strong understanding of sales principles, client relationship management, and a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, sales analytics tools, and proficiency in Microsoft Office are typically required. Outstanding communication, negotiation, and problem-solving skills enable you to build rapport and effectively address client needs. These abilities are crucial for driving sales growth, maintaining client satisfaction, and achieving organizational targets.

How does an associate sales account manager typically collaborate with other departments to achieve sales targets?

As an Associate Sales Account Manager, you will frequently work with cross-functional teams such as marketing, customer support, and product development to address client needs and drive sales growth. Collaboration often involves sharing client feedback with product teams, coordinating with marketing for promotional materials, and working with customer support to resolve any post-sale issues. This team-oriented environment not only helps achieve sales targets but also provides exposure to different business functions, which can broaden your skillset and open up future career advancement opportunities.

What is the difference between Associate Sales Account Manager vs Sales Representative?

AspectAssociate Sales Account ManagerSales Representative
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or related fieldOften requires a high school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er a bachelor's degree
Work EnvironmentUsually works in a corporate office or client site, managing existing accountsPrimarily field-based, focusing on prospecting and new client acquisition
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in B2B sales within technology, manufacturing, and service industriesWidely used across retail, wholesale, and direct sales sectors

The Associate Sales Account Manager typically handles existing client relationships and account growth within a corporate setting, requiring more strategic skills. In contrast, a Sales Representative often focuses on generating new leads and closing sales, frequently working in the field. Both roles are essential in sales teams but differ in scope and daily responsibilities.

About BIS Digital

BIS Digital is a technology company providing integrated communication solutions using audio, video, presentation, and computer systems. Since 1982 the mission of BIS Digital has been to create the best digital recording solutions available in the marketplace.

Position:

Sales Manager

The sales manager will perform various roles related to driving new and existing business in the sales region. This includes maintaining relationships, demonstrating technology, establishing new business relationships, and attending trade shows. The account manager will work remotely from a home office, spending up to 50% of the time on site with new and existing customers.

Responsibilities:

  • Drive business plan to meet annual revenue objectives
  • Develop and maintain a thorough knowledge of all BIS?s product offerings
  • Identify leads, manage prospects and acquire new business
  • Determine customer requirements and propose appropriate solutions
  • Prepare and present sales proposals and follow up with key decision makers
  • Utilize CRM daily scheduling and documenting customer activities
  • Review weekly activities, progress on goals, and status of prospective customers with regional sales director
  • Other related duties as assigned
